Labview中DataGridView的高级应用与界面优化
版权申诉

在现代的编程与系统集成领域,LabVIEW作为一种图形化编程语言和开发环境,在工程和科研领域中扮演着重要角色。LabVIEW 的用户界面设计功能强大,其中的 DataGridView 控件是实现数据表格展示和管理的常用工具。本例程探讨了LabVIEW环境下DataGridView的应用,内容涵盖了以下几个方面:
1. 基于LabVIEW的DataGridView应用例程
首先,LabVIEW本身提供了丰富的控件和功能模块,使得开发者可以构建出具有高度交互性的用户界面。DataGridView控件是实现复杂数据展示和编辑的重要工具,它能够显示多行多列的数据,并允许用户对这些数据进行各种操作。
在LabVIEW环境中,开发者可以通过控件调用库或使用LabVIEW自带的函数实现DataGridView的创建。创建过程中,开发者能够详细定义DataGridView的外观,包括列宽、行高等属性,以及单元格的编辑风格等。
2.DataGridView可用作优化界面风格
LabVIEW的用户界面设计往往需要良好的用户体验(UX)和界面美感。DataGridView控件不仅提供了数据展示的功能,还可以通过各种视觉效果的定制来优化界面风格。
例如,开发者可以根据实际需要设置特定的单元格格式、颜色、字体样式等,甚至可以为单元格添加图标或图片,来增强数据的表现力。此外,还可以设置控件响应用户操作时的视觉反馈效果,比如当鼠标悬停在某行时,该行变色以提示用户。
3.对表格的操作更强大
LabVIEW的DataGridView控件提供的不仅仅是静态的数据展示,它还可以执行各种数据操作,如排序、过滤、搜索和数据绑定等。LabVIEW通过事件驱动的方式,使得用户可以很容易地为DataGridView添加各种事件处理程序,从而实现更复杂的数据交互逻辑。
开发者可以使用LabVIEW的数据操作和数据流逻辑,对DataGridView中的数据进行排序或筛选,而无需编写繁琐的代码。同时,DataGridView控件与LabVIEW的数据类型兼容性良好,可与数组、簇、枚举等数据结构无缝连接,使得数据处理更为高效。
4.示例文件的描述和使用
提供的文件名为LabVIEWdotNetDataGrid,这很可能是一个LabVIEW项目文件,该项目文件包含了实现DataGridView应用的具体代码和资源。开发者可以通过打开该LabVIEW项目文件来查看详细的实现方法,学习如何使用LabVIEW的DataGridView控件,并根据自己的需要修改和扩展该例程。
此项目文件可能包含了各种VI(虚拟仪器)和控件的布局,其中VI是LabVIEW中进行编程和逻辑处理的最小单位。开发者通过分析这些VI和控件之间的数据流和逻辑关系,可以深入理解LabVIEWDataGridView应用例程的工作原理和实现方式。
总结来说,LabVIEW的DataGridView应用例程展示了如何利用LabVIEW强大的图形化编程和界面设计功能,实现复杂数据的展示和操作。开发者可以根据这个例程的思路和结构,快速搭建出适应自己项目需求的用户界面和数据处理逻辑。
152 浏览量
166 浏览量
2025-02-25 上传
192 浏览量
2010-01-25 上传
2011-06-09 上传

千源万码
- 粉丝: 1125
最新资源
- LiberMate 到 Python (scipy/numpy) 的MATLAB转换器
- 探索HTML在个人博客网站中的应用实践
- FPGA技术打造的数字时钟项目实现与验证
- 新版kindEditor增强功能与兼容性改进
- IPMSG飞鸽传书源码解析与应用
- 华为USG防火墙固件版本详解
- WPlot: Qt5上的C++11图形库
- 掌握Spark大数据处理的关键技术
- 基于GSM的Arduino远程灌溉控制器实现
- Maven、Spring与Mybatis项目整合实践指南
- ADS2008中的ATF54143元器件模型实例解析
- 自定义带导航功能的ListView控件教程
- 基于Java SpringBoot的用户权限管理系统优化
- Django驱动的dpaste.de项目开源实践
- RAD Studio XE补丁修复TClientDataSet负数错误
- Myflow: 画流程图神器,支持Web界面拖拽操作